There are n ( n − 1) 2 (see (b)) games … WebThe probability of any outcome is the long-term relative frequency of that outcome. Probabilities are between zero and one, inclusive (that is, zero and one and all numbers between these values). P ( A) = 0 means the event A can never happen. P ( A) = 1 means the event A always happens. WebThe probability of an event is written P (A), and describes the long-run relative frequency of the event. The first two basic rules of probability are the following: Rule 1: Any probability P (A) is a number between 0 and 1 (0 < P (A) < 1). Web24 apr. 2024 · A probability distribution is a list of the possible outcomes with corresponding probabilities that satis es three rules: The outcomes listed must be disjoint. Each probability must be between 0 and 1. The probabilities must total 1. Exercise 2.20 Table 2.6 suggests three distributions for household income in the United States.
